Battier is out for tonights game..

http://www.eastvalleytribune.com/story/113580
Shane Battier will not play for the Houston Rockets tonight when they host the Suns in a key Western Conference game for playoff seeding.

Battier has been ruled out after he injured his left foot and ankle during the second half of Houston's 103-80 win over Seattle on Wednesday.

The Rockets will have all-star Tracy McGrady back after he missed Wedcnesday's game with a sore left shoulder that has bothered him for more than a week.

Houston currently holds the No. 3 seed in the West with a 53-25 record, but would fall behind the fifth-seeded Suns (53-26) with a loss tonight.
